GridColumnStylesCollection.RemoveAt(Int32)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Entfernt den DataGridColumnStyle mit dem angegebenen Index aus der GridColumnStylesCollection.
public:
void RemoveAt(int index);
public void RemoveAt (int index);
member this.RemoveAt : int -> unit
Public Sub RemoveAt (index As Integer)
Parameter
- index
- Int32
Der nullbasierte Index der zu entfernenden DataGridColumnStyle-Instanz.
Beispiele
Im folgenden Codebeispiel wird die Contains -Methode verwendet, um zu bestimmen, ob eine bestimmte DataGridColumnStyle in einer GridColumnStylesCollectionvorhanden ist. Wenn dies der Grund ist, gibt die IndexOf Methode den Index von DataGridColumnStylezurück, und die Remove -Methode wird mit dem Index aufgerufen, um das Element aus der Auflistung zu entfernen.
Private Sub RemoveCol(ByVal dc As DataColumn)
Dim myGridColumns As GridColumnStylesCollection
myGridColumns = DataGrid1.TableStyles(0).GridColumnStyles
If myGridColumns.Contains("FirstName") Then
Dim i As Integer
i = myGridColumns.IndexOf(myGridColumns("FirstName"))
myGridColumns.RemoveAt(i)
End If
End Sub
Hinweise
Verwenden Sie die Contains -Methode, um zu bestimmen, ob in DataGridColumnStyle der Auflistung vorhanden ist.
Verwenden Sie die IndexOf -Methode, um den Index eines beliebigen Elements in der Auflistung zu bestimmen.